Job Description
The Senior Data Analyst leads enterprise-level data initiatives by combining technical expertise
with strategic insight. This role is responsible for driving data governance, advanced analytics,
integration projects, and dashboard development to support the organization's mission - including
initiatives in affordable housing and enterprise-wide operations. The ideal candidate is a seasoned
data professional with strong leadership skills, hands-on technical ability, and a passion for
delivering data-driven insights.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Lead and manage cross-functional data governance, migration, integration, and analytics projects
aligned with strategic organizational goals.
Design and implement robust dashboards and visualizations using Power BI, ensuring clarity,performance, and data accuracy.
Write, optimize, and maintain complex SQL queries for data extraction, transformation, andreporting across multiple platforms.
Develop and enforce data governance standards, policies, and best practices acrossdepartments.
Integrate with external APIs and enterprise systems to support real-time data ingestion andanalysis.
Mentor junior analysts, fostering a culture of growth, collaboration, and analyticalexcellence.
Translate complex data into actionable insights for both technical and non-technicalstakeholders.
Manage project timelines, stakeholder expectations, and reporting deliverables across businessunits.
SKILLS & QUALIFICATIONS
Proficiency in Power BI, including data modeling (DAX, M language), report design, andperformance tuning.
Experience with dashboarding and data storytelling to communicate trends and opportunitieseffectively.
SQL development skills with the ability to query and manipulate large datasets.Familiarity with RESTful APIs and integrating external data sources into enterprisesystems.
Strong analytical, critical thinking, and problem-solving capabilities.Demonstrated leadership in managing analytics initiatives and cross-functionalcollaboration.
Knowledge of data warehousing, data modeling, and ETL / ELT processes.Effective communicator with the ability to explain technical concepts clearly to non-technicalaudiences.
EXPERIENCE & EDUCATION
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Information Systems, Finance, or relatedfield.
